  • (lb) An instrument of observation, whose graduated limb consists of an entire circle. When fixed to a wall in an observatory, it is called a mural circle''; when mounted with a telescope on an axis and in Y's, in the plane of the meridian, a ''meridian'' or ''transit circle''; when involving the principle of reflection, like the sextant, a ''reflecting circle''; and when that of repeating an angle several times continuously along the graduated limb, a ''repeating circle .

  • (lb) A form of argument in which two or more unproved statements are used to prove each other; inconclusive reasoning.
  • *(Joseph Glanvill) (1636-1680)
  • *:That heavy bodies descend by gravity; and, again, that gravity is a quality whereby a heavy body descends, is an impertinent circle and teaches nothing.
